问(問)wèn(wen4)
The character 问 (wèn) means 'to ask' or 'to inquire.' It is commonly used when seeking information or clarification and can be used in various contexts, such as asking questions in a conversation, making inquiries in a formal setting, or even when requesting help.

Quick Contrast
询 (xún) - use 问 (wèn) for general inquiries, while 询 (xún) is often more formal or specific.

Usage Notes
Be mindful of the tone; 问 is pronounced with a falling tone (4th tone), which can change the meaning if mispronounced. It is often used in phrases like '问候' (to greet) and '问问题' (to ask a question). Avoid using it in overly formal writing where more sophisticated terms may be appropriate.

Common Mistakes
Learners often confuse 问 with 说 (shuō, to say), leading to sentences like '我问他说什么' (wǒ wèn tā shuō shénme), which incorrectly mixes the meanings. The correct form should be '我问他' (wǒ wèn tā, I ask him).
